Cat Meows, Gary Numan and Growing Up Weird: A Chat with Beatowls' Darcie Chazen.

"I was that strange child who'd just mimic everything," Darcie grins. "Cat meows, scraping metal, Christina Aguilera's vocal runs—anything that made an interesting sound." Years before Beatowls, before their shape-shifting single "(Do You Want To Be) Loved," there was just a kid with perfect pitch and a legendary playground Donkey impression.

Between stories of Gary Numan-soundtracked visits to her dad's and reimagined Jewish folk songs, Darcie maps out a musical landscape that's distinctly Liverpudlian yet entirely her own.
